Trials in civil cases

Mesothelioma lawsuits can be a bit complicated, but many claims reach settlement agreements before reaching trial. If a case is brought to trial the jury will determine what compensation the victim is eligible for. A verdict at trial can be appealed, which could delay compensation payments for months or even years.

Personal injury lawsuits make up the majority of mesothelioma litigation cases filed in the United States. They seek financial compensation to cover medical bills, lost wages and other costs. The money from a mesothelioma lawsuit will not restore health or bring back a loved one, but it can help the victims and their families get the best care possible.

The discovery phase of a mesothelioma claim - Visit Homepage - can last for months as attorneys compile evidence and witnesses. A mesothelioma lawyer will interview former and current workers who could provide valuable information regarding asbestos exposure. The lawyer will also collect medical records to prove asbestos exposure is the cause of mesothelioma legal. In this phase the client could be asked to take an interview that is recorded and played to the jury in the case of a trial.

Wrongful death lawsuits seek compensation for the loss of a family member to mesothelioma or another asbestos-related illness. These lawsuits seek justice by holding accountable individuals accountable for their negligence in exposing victims to asbestos. These claims are brought by children, spouses or other dependents of a loved one who has passed away.

Compensation for mesothelioma cases could include punitive, non-economic and economic damages. Economic damages may include past and future medical costs as well as lost wages and funeral expenses. Non-economic damages can include pain and discomfort as well as loss of consortium and emotional distress. Punitive damages are a form of punishment designed to stop asbestos-related companies from engaging in illegal or oppressive practices, or committing grossly negligent conduct.
